Wunderkraut väljer Elastx som hostingleverantör

Elastx har ingått ett partnerskap med Wunderkraut som designar och bygger webbplatser baserade på Drupal. Vi träffade två av grundarna, Tomas Persson och Fabian von Tiedemann för att ställa ett par frågor.

 

Vad är Wunderkraut?

- Wunderkraut är en ledande Europeisk webbyrå med fokus på att skapa digitala mervärden genom agil utveckling och Open Source-teknologier. Wunderkraut är ett entreprenörsdrivet företag och samtliga ägare jobbar också som anställda. Vi hjälper företag genom 4 faser av webbplatsens livscykel. Enkelt beskrivet är dessa behovsanalys, förberedelse, utveckling och förbättring. Hög kvalitet och snabb "time to market" blir allt viktigare. Därför erbjuder vi även professionell hosting för våra kunder. Wunderkraut bygger webbplatser med mätbara affärsresultat och är experter på webbanalys, design, utveckling, förvaltning, hosting och Drupal CMS. Wunderkraut består av 150 experter och är Europas ledande leverantör av Drupal.

 

Vad är Drupal?

- Drupal är ett open source CMS (Content Management System) där man på ett enkelt sätt kan organisera, underhålla och publicera innehåll. Drupal är ett moget, säkert och flexibelt ramverk för webbaserade verksamheter att bygga samt förbättra sina webbplatser. Drupal är Open Source vilket innebär att det är gratis att använda.

 

Vilka använde ni innan för hosting och vilka var utmaningarna?

- Vi har provat de flesta leverantörer och upplägg som t.ex. lokala leverantörer, större IT infrastruktur-leverantörer, kundens egna IT-avdelning samt molnleverantörer som Amazon AWS och Linode. Den främsta utmaningen har alltid varit bristen på kunskap vad som krävs för att drifta en webbplats. Det var en av anledningarna att vi hade flyttat det mesta av våra webbplatser till molnleverantörer innan vi hittade Elastx.

"Wunderkraut rekommenderar Elastx framför AWS alla dagar i veckan när prestanda och tillgänglighet är prioriterat" - Fabian von Tiedemann, delägare Wunderkraut

 

Wunderkraut använder nu Elastx. Vilka märkbara skillnader / förbättringar?

- De främsta förbättringarna är flexibiliteten, prestandan, stabiliteten i plattformen samt att det finns kunnig och teknisk lokal support.

 

Kan ni berätta om vad ni kör hos Elastx?

- Vi kör främst en LAMP stack som är anpassad för Drupal med:

  • Nginx (Proxy cache och lastbalanserare)
  • Apache
  • MySQL
  • Memcache

Vi jobbar också på en Jetty container för horisontell skalning av Apache Solr (idag använder vi en reserverad instans)

 

Hur mycket resurser har ni sparat varje dag genom att använda Elastx jelastic:PaaS?

- Vi har märkt en 53% reducering av byggtiderna på våra utvecklingsservrar eftersom plattformen automatiskt skalar efter behov. Kunden har alltid tillgång till kapacitet exakt när det behövs. Tidigare så var vi tvungna att ha en mängd extra instanser bara för att kunna hantera toppar i belastningen. Vi kan numera begränsa antalet byggservrar eftersom miljön automatiskt skalar upp kapaciteten vid behov. Detta innebär minskade kostnader och arbetstid.  

 

Hur har ni upplevt Elastx support jämfört med tidigare leverantörer?

- Det enkla svaret. Betydligt bättre! Elastx support är verkligen dedikerade och man får verkligen hjälp när man behöver det. Vi uppskattar den gedigna tekniska kompetensen som är något vi saknat hos de tidigare leverantörerna.

 

Hur kan Drupal prestera så bra i Elastx jelastic:PaaS?

- Drupal är byggt på PHP. Det betyder att när en webbplats är under hård belastning (många besökare) och ingenting har hunnit cachas i minnet så är man väldigt beroende av CPU. Det finns många sätt att hantera cachning i Drupal som till exempel Opcode caches, Memcache, Databas cache. Styrkan med Drupal är att det är flexibelt, det behövs eftersom varje webbplats är unik med sina egna användarmönster och kapacitetsbehov. Standardlösningen tidigare har varit att se till att det finns tillräckligt med serverkapacitet och hålla tummarna för att det räcker. Med Elastx så behöver vi inte fundera på det längre eftersom miljön automatiskt skalar upp vid behov. Självklart behövs miljön fortfarande övervakas ifall den kräver onormalt mycket resurser eftersom det kostar mer, men det är fortfarande betydligt bättre än att försöka lösa det medans kundens webbplats ligger nere. 

 

Har ni planer på att flytta flera kunder till Elastx?

- Ja, vi planerar att flytta så många som möjligt av våra kunder till Elastx jelastic:PaaS plattform. Det är enklare och roligare att underhålla kundmiljöerna i Elastx plattform. Alla kunder som vi flyttat hittills är mycket nöjda över den förbättrade prestandan.

 

Vilka förbättringar skulle ni vilja se i plattformen?

- En "performance shared file system" lösning samt att vi själva kan hantera lokala brandväggsregler (för att stödja kommunikation mellan vår management-server och instanser)

Elastx tackar för intervjun med Tomas och Fabian och ser framemot att fortsätta vårt spännande samarbete. 

Läs mer på Wunderkraut.se

Share